SEC 504 - Advanced Theory and Practice in Teaching Secondary Mathematics
Corequisites: SEC 500. Focus on the connections between theory and practice in teaching mathematics with emphasis on the role of inquiry in informing instruction. Opportunities to design and implement lessons in mathematics using a variety of instructional strategies that meet curriculum objectives, as well as address the needs of diverse learners. Reflection and self analysis are emphasized throughout the course.
3.000 Credit hours
3.000 Lecture hours

Levels: Graduate
Schedule Types: Lecture
